Travis Kelce Opens Up More About Wedding to Taylor Swift
Travis Kelce Calls Taylor Swift Wedding an Unforgettable Night
Kabarsaji.com – Travis Kelce has shared more details about his July wedding to Taylor Swift, describing the celebration at Madison Square Garden as a deeply personal occasion that surpassed his expectations.
The Kansas City Chiefs tight end reflected on the ceremony during a conversation with teammate Patrick Mahomes and ESPN’s Chris Berman. When Berman jokingly asked whether Kelce had gotten married, the football star confirmed the news before responding with a playful question of his own about whether Berman had attended.
“It was the best night of my life. Marrying Taylor was, you know, it was more than I could have ever dreamed it to be.”
Kelce’s comments focused less on the scale of the venue and more on the emotion of bringing loved ones together. Madison Square Garden, one of New York City’s most recognizable entertainment spaces, provided the setting for a celebration designed to feel private despite its famous location.
A Celebration Built Around Family and Friends
He also discussed the wedding on the September 2 episode of New Heights, the podcast he hosts alongside his brother, Jason Kelce. In that conversation, Kelce recalled the vows, the guests and the stories that continued to circulate after the event itself had ended.
“The night was a night I’ll never forget... from the vows to, you know, just seeing everyone, to how much fun we had throughout the entire evening and hearing that kind of be relayed through everybody’s stories of the night.”
For Kelce, the lasting impression came from the atmosphere created by the people in attendance. He called the event magical and said he wished the evening could have continued longer. His description suggested that the ceremony was planned as a shared experience rather than simply a high-profile celebrity event.

Why Madison Square Garden Was Chosen
Kelce said he and Swift wanted a place that would allow the celebration to remain sincere, close-knit and protected from distractions. Privacy was a central consideration in choosing the venue, even though Madison Square Garden is usually associated with major concerts, sporting events and large public gatherings.
“We wanted to do it somewhere where we could have a very intimate and genuine setting without a lot of distractions and we needed it to be a private feel.”
He credited the venue with exceeding those expectations. The choice demonstrates how a familiar public landmark can be transformed for a private milestone when the event is carefully arranged around the couple’s priorities.

Gratitude for the Team Behind the Event
Kelce also made a point of thanking everyone who attended and those who worked behind the scenes. Major weddings require coordination among venue staff, planners, hospitality teams and many other contributors, and he acknowledged that the celebration depended on more than the couple alone.
“I can’t thank everybody enough”
His appreciation extended to both the guests who shared the day and the people who helped make it happen. That recognition fits with his broader recollection of the event: a wedding defined by warmth, participation and a sense of occasion.
While Kelce has spoken enthusiastically about the day, his remarks have consistently returned to its emotional value. The most important part, he indicated, was marrying Swift and celebrating with the people closest to them. For him, the July ceremony remains a once-in-a-lifetime memory—one he says exceeded anything he had imagined.
